What's Aysgarth like for family-friendly holidays?
The relaxing destination of Aysgarth is a good choice if you've been considering a getaway with your children. The beautiful waterfalls, parks and walking trails are just some of the things that make this a good destination for family holidays. Take to the air and fly into Durham (MME-Teesside Intl.), which is located 27.3 mi (43.9 km) from the city centre.

When's the best time to book a family-friendly holiday in Aysgarth?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 3°C. Average annual precipitation for Aysgarth is 1256 mm.
What's there to see and do with your family in Aysgarth?
Yorkshire Dales National Park, The Forbidden Corner and Richmond Market Place are interesting attractions that you and your family will enjoy exploring while you are staying in Aysgarth. Make sure that you have lots of time for activities such as Jervaulx Abbey and The Station.
